If there is no power, confirm the circuit breaker has not tripped.This enables you to turn the Clock display on or off. To do this, you press and hold the Display On/Off pad on the control panel for about 3 seconds. The Display On/Off feature cannot be used while a cooking feature is in use. This just turns the Clock on or off in the display.

This will change the microwave time.When a GE, LG, Maytag, Samsung or Whirlpool microwave fuse blows, you can check it by doing a continuity test. This test involves disconnecting the fuse and touching the leads of an ohmmeter to each terminal and checking the resistance, which should be close to 0. If you prefer not to display the time: Disconnect the power for 30 seconds. After restoring power, do not set the clock. If your model has an ON/OFF clock display, you can choose not to have the time displayed. To choose this option, press the 0 pad for about three seconds. To Turn the display back on, press ...

If the microwave turns off before the set cooking time is complete, it can be due to a covered or blocked oven vent around the case. Uncover the vent or reposition the microwave oven so that the vents are not blocked. This will ensure there is adequate airflow around the oven. GE microwave ovens have a built-in feature that produces a "beep" each time a button is pressed. This audio feature is meant to alert you that a button has been pressed on the appliance. Most Helpful Answer. You have an aging, failing capacitor on the control board. (Capacitors can get old just sitting on the shelf). You can try to find a new control panel which will probably cost about the same as a new machine. Or, for probably under $10, you can replace all the capacitors on the board, usually three.
